On Thu, Nov 17, 2022 at 12:23:50AM +0000, Sean Christopherson wrote:
> Automatically disable single-step when the guest reaches the end of the
> verified section instead of using an explicit ucall() to ask userspace to
> disable single-step.  An upcoming change to implement a pool-based scheme
> for ucall() will add an atomic operation (bit test and set) in the guest
> ucall code, and if the compiler generate "old school" atomics, e.g.

>   40e57c:       c85f7c20        ldxr    x0, [x1]
>   40e580:       aa100011        orr     x17, x0, x16
>   40e584:       c80ffc31        stlxr   w15, x17, [x1]
>   40e588:       35ffffaf        cbnz    w15, 40e57c <__aarch64_ldset8_sync+0x1c>
> 
> the guest will hang as the local exclusive monitor is reset by eret,
> i.e. the stlxr will always fail due to the VM-Exit for the debug
> exception.

... due to the debug exception taken to EL2.
